§ 43-40-15 — Renewal of license

North Dakota·Title 43 Occupations and Professions·Ch. 43-40 Occupational Therapists
1.Any license issued under this chapter is subject to biennial renewal and expires unless renewed in the manner prescribed by the rules of the board. The board may provide for the late renewal of a license upon the payment of a late fee in accordance with its rules, but late renewal of a license may not be granted more than three years after its expiration.
2.The board may establish additional requirements for license renewal which provide evidence of continuing competency.
